First of all, let us discuss the components associated with the reverse osmosis that make it advanced and thus preferable:

  • Water supply line valve:it is from the supply valve that the user gets the raw water; it is an end to end connection between the water supply and the system.
  • Pretreatment mechanism: Sometimes the condition of the water is such that the raw water supply needs to be pre-filtered in order to be made fit to be further treated by reverse osmosis.
  • Semi-permeable membrane:one can say that the semi-permeable membrane is the center of attraction of the whole reverse osmosis system.
  • Post-treatment mechanism:in the post-treatment process the reverse osmosis works on the elimination of taste and odors from the water for that the water goes through another filter or a whole set of new filters that has the carbon, sediments, and many other things added.
  • Check valve assembly: This component of the reverse osmosis system stops the purified water from running back towards the membrane.
  • Flow restrictor:This flow restrictor works on the interference of the uneven flow and thus protects the quality of the water.
  • Storage Tank:The best thing about an RO system is that it comes in various storage tank sizes the user can decide and buy an RO system as per the needed storage capacity.
  • Auto- shut off valve: As soon as the storage tank will be filled the further purification of water will be stopped then and there.
  • Faucet/Tap: This medium would finally deliver the treated water to be taken into use by the people mostly for drinking purposes.
  • Drain Pipe:This is the pipe through which all the impure water is given a run towards an outlet or a drain.

Talking in detail regarding the working procedure of the sewage treatment plant one can say that the process is divided into three stages those are primary, secondary, and tertiary treatment. Here as we will move further we will be discussing each of the stages in more detail so that it would get clearer in the heads of the people using the plant.

The process of removing pollutants from the wastewater with the help of the sewage treatment plant can be done in the following way:

  • Primary treatment: In the primary treatment process the solid waste and all of that waste that can be easily extracted from the water manually is removed.
  • Secondary Treatment:In the secondary treatment the microorganisms are used by the sewage treatment plant for the removal of all the needless elements from the wastewater.
  • Tertiary Treatment:This is the last and final stage of the sewage treatment that is done by the sewage treatment plant, in this stage the quality of water is improved, and then that improved water is released into the environment. Also, at this stage, the water is treated for removal of phosphorus and nitrogen from it.

The advantages associated with a RO water treatment plant are given as follows:

  • The plant works on very low powers.
  • The plants are compactly designed and therefore they need less space.
  • There is not much learning or training needed for the operations of reverse osmosis plants it is so because it works on some standardized equipment.
  • Mostly the reverse osmosis plants are fully automatic and thus they do not demand much labor.
  • The RO plants are also very easy to be maintained.

The limitations associated with the RO water treatment plants are given as follows:

  • As it is a pressure-related technique therefore it becomes important to have applied pressure exceeded the osmotic pressure.
  • The plant cannot be taken into use without pretreatment as otherwise, the membrane will start giving a foul smell.
  • The long term investment in the reverse osmosis plant goes higher in comparison to the UF water treatment plant.

The advantages associated with the Ultrafiltration plant are given as follows:

  • The UF membranes are available in different sizes therefore the water treatment through the Ultrafiltration plantcan be done at anywhere on anything.
  • Also, the energy needs of a UF plant are very low.
  • UF is the best water treatment plant for things that are sensitive to temperature.
  • In the UF plants, it is easy to start the operations again after switching off the plant.
  • Also, the design of the plants is simple and compact.

The disadvantages associated with the Ultrafiltration plant are given as follows:

  • The UF plant technique is not capable of removing dissolved salts from the water.
  • The odor of the water cannot be changed.
  • The water treated by these plants is not suitable for the drinking purposes of animals or human beings as the dissolved salts in the water are very harmful to the bodies.

So, here is all the basic important information that is associated with the oil filter machine or as we say it the oil filtration plant, if this needs to be kept in more simple words then one can say that these plants or the machines are basically used for the process of power generation. The high vacuum transformer oil filtration plant is used on the transformers for keeping the impurities away from the oil so that it4 becomes easy for the transformers to work efficiently. The role of an oil filtration plant is very much important in the process of electricity production but it is often seen that the oil as it works continuously therefore as a result the sludge starts forming and thus the free flow of oil gets blocked.

So, it is through these advanced oil filtration machines that the oil of the transformers is kept away from the sludge so that the transformer works properly without much delay and thus it becomes possible to meet the power demand well in time. First of all, let us start with the basic introduction of welding fume; one can say that the welding fumes and other harmful gases are all very small particles that are emitted during the process of welding fusion. In general and in more simple words it can be said that fume is any type of pollution of the atmosphere that takes rise from the arc.

Now if we take this discussion further, and talk regarding the importance of fume extraction and treatment in a welding industry then we can say that at a place where welding is done it often happens that the problem of temperature control and the problem of air contamination arise and thus the need for fresh air increases. As a result, the fresh air that comes through natural ventilation is just not enough so that is where comes, the use of local fume extraction as it has been the most effective source for the fume control in the welding industry.

Another point for which the use of a fume extraction system becomes important at a commercial setup is because of the exposure of the welders and the other people in the industry to the harmful fumes. Every industrialist especially the one who owns a welding industry is expected to keep an eye on the fume production always if the workers are getting exposed to fumes at a level that is higher than the occupational exposure levels then it is time to get a fume extractor installed at the place. This ensures the safety and security of the workers and also of their health.

Given below are the factors that one needs to consider in order to check the amount of fume and the toxicity hazards that are generated:

  • Types of materials that are being provided with the welding and cutting.
  • Parameters of the process.
  • Time duration and the frequency of the process in the whole operation.
  • The position and location of the operations.
  • General ventilation and the air movements in the area.

There are various types of fume extraction equipment from which a person can use anyone as per the requirement for the process of treatment of the fumes. The various types of fume extraction equipment include high- volume/low-velocity systems and also low volume/high-velocity systems.

Other than this there are also fixed units of the fume extractor and also there are portable units of the fume extractor. But if it is regarding selecting the right fume extractor then, in that case, it would depend on the place where it is to be used if there is enough space and the requirement of the fume treatment is more, then one should go for the fixed fume extraction system if that is not the case then obviously the portable fume extractor would suit best in the scenario. In order to start with, we will take our first move towards the Wet scrubbers reason they being the most popular type of scrubbers that are taken into use by the people for controlling the air pollution at the industries.  Basically, as the name suggests the wet scrubbers work towards the control of air pollution through water or through other types of liquid agents. Talking regarding the working procedure of the wet scrubber we can say that the liquid is generally enclosed in a metal or composite type of container. The dirty air or the gas passes through the liquid and the liquid absorbs all the pollutants. As a result, this whole process the gas or the air that comes out of the scrubber is generally cleaner and fit to be released in the environment. The wet scrubber is also different from other types of scrubbers because the merging of liquid with the gas gets the moisture level increased in the gas that is put to treatment and thus as the gas is cleaned a visible cloud comes out of the scrubber.

Now the wet scrubbers have been discussed well in detail and there is no stone left unturned for them so we shall now further move to the discussion related to the dry scrubbers talking regarding the dry scrubbers one can say that the dry scrubbers are not seen using any sort of liquid for the absorbing the contaminants. In order to make the dry scrubber work, generally, a dry reaction material for absorbing the contaminants is mixed with the polluted gas. The dry scrubbers are mainly used for the efficient removal of acids from the gases.

The agent that is used for the removal of acid from the gas is mostly made of alkaline slurry; the slurry is used for the purpose of neutralizing the acid present in the gas. The acid-neutralizing agent can be merged with the acid gas in two different ways one is through the dry sorbent injection the other is through the spray dry sorbent. In the first method, the gas is mixed directly into the alkaline sorbent whereas in the other method the contaminated gas goes through the mist of the sorbent.

Now, that all the information regarding the dry scrubbers has been collected, so we can now further move to the discussion related to the electrostatic precipitators. Talking regarding them one can say that they are the most unique type of scrubbers that are known for using charged energy for the removal of dust and other contaminants from the gas. Taking as an example of these types of scrubbers we can count on the plate precipitator. The plate is actually a metal sheet that is charged.  The plates usually run parallel along with the piping and the gas passes through the plates in order to remove the dust.
